[Paper Review] Developing and Deploying Industry Standards for Artificial Intelligence in Education (AIED): Challenges, Strategies, and Future Directions

Richard M. Tong, Haoyang Li|arXiv (Cornell University)|Mar 13, 2024
Online Learning and Analytics4 citations
TL;DR

This paper proposes a multi-tiered framework for developing and deploying industry standards in Artificial Intelligence in Education (AIED), addressing interoperability, scalability, and ethical governance through stakeholder collaboration, iterative development, and alignment with global standards like IEEE and ISO. The key contribution is a strategic roadmap for creating equitable, trustworthy, and globally adoptable AIED systems.

ABSTRACT

The adoption of Artificial Intelligence in Education (AIED) holds the promise of revolutionizing educational practices by offering personalized learning experiences, automating administrative and pedagogical tasks, and reducing the cost of content creation. However, the lack of standardized practices in the development and deployment of AIED solutions has led to fragmented ecosystems, which presents challenges in interoperability, scalability, and ethical governance. This article aims to address the critical need to develop and implement industry standards in AIED, offering a comprehensive analysis of the current landscape, challenges, and strategic approaches to overcome these obstacles. We begin by examining the various applications of AIED in various educational settings and identify key areas lacking in standardization, including system interoperability, ontology mapping, data integration, evaluation, and ethical governance. Then, we propose a multi-tiered framework for establishing robust industry standards for AIED. In addition, we discuss methodologies for the iterative development and deployment of standards, incorporating feedback loops from real-world applications to refine and adapt standards over time. The paper also highlights the role of emerging technologies and pedagogical theories in shaping future standards for AIED. Finally, we outline a strategic roadmap for stakeholders to implement these standards, fostering a cohesive and ethical AIED ecosystem. By establishing comprehensive industry standards, such as those by IEEE Artificial Intelligence Standards Committee (AISC) and International Organization for Standardization (ISO), we can accelerate and scale AIED solutions to improve educational outcomes, ensuring that technological advances align with the principles of inclusivity, fairness, and educational excellence.

Motivation & Objective

  • Address the fragmented landscape of AIED due to lack of standardized practices in system interoperability, data integration, and ethical governance.
  • Overcome challenges in scaling AIED solutions across diverse educational contexts and socioeconomic environments.
  • Establish a collaborative framework involving educational institutions, technology providers, regulators, and learners to ensure equitable and effective AIED deployment.
  • Develop a systematic, iterative methodology for creating and updating AIED standards based on real-world feedback and technological evolution.
  • Align emerging AIED standards with global regulatory frameworks such as the EU AI Act and ISO/IEC JTC 1/SC 42 to ensure legal compliance and technical robustness.

Proposed method

  • Propose a multi-tiered framework that leverages existing standards (e.g., IEEE Learning Technology Standards, IEEE AISC), builds AIED-specific standards, and extends them for emerging technologies like GenAI and LLMs.
  • Integrate stakeholder engagement across educational institutions, technology developers, regulators, and learners to co-create standards with diverse perspectives.
  • Implement iterative development cycles with pilot deployments to test and refine standards in real-world educational settings.
  • Establish feedback loops from field applications to continuously improve and adapt standards over time.
  • Align AIED standards with international regulatory frameworks such as the EU AI Act and ISO/IEC JTC 1/SC 42 for global consistency and compliance.
  • Advocate for policy and regulatory support through incentives, funding, and accountability mechanisms to drive adoption and enforcement of AIED standards.

Key findings

  • The lack of standardized practices in AIED leads to fragmented ecosystems that hinder interoperability, scalability, and ethical governance across educational platforms.
  • A multi-tiered framework—leveraging, building, and extending standards—provides a scalable and inclusive approach to AIED standardization.
  • Collaboration among educational institutions, technology providers, and regulatory bodies is essential to ensure AIED systems are accessible and equitable across diverse learner populations.
  • Iterative development with real-world pilot implementations enables continuous improvement and adaptation of AIED standards to evolving technological and pedagogical needs.
  • Alignment with the EU AI Act and ISO/IEC JTC 1/SC 42 ensures that AIED standards meet global regulatory and technical requirements for risk management, transparency, and data governance.
  • A strategic roadmap for coalition-building, needs assessment, and policy advocacy provides a clear, actionable path for stakeholders to implement and enforce AIED standards at scale.
